Lunar Orbiter 3

Also known as Lunar Orbiter-C, Orbiter-C, Orbiter III, LunarOrbiter3

NASA · Launched

Explore trajectory

Completed · Partial success

NASA lunar orbiter that photographed the lunar surface to confirm safe landing sites for the Surveyor and Apollo missions. It returned 477 high resolution and 149 medium resolution frames, including a frame showing the Surveyor 1 landing site, before its film advance motor burned out, and was commanded to impact the Moon on 9 October 1967.
